Acer palmatum 'Emerald Lace'
Am I evergreen?
No, "Acer palmatum 'Emerald Lace'" is not evergreen. It is a deciduous plant. In the winter, the leaves of this plant will fall.
How many degrees of winter hardiness am I?
The plant Acer palmatum 'Emerald Lace' is winter hardy to about -15 degrees Celsius. It is therefore important to protect the plant from severe frost in winter. It is advisable to cover the plant with fleece cloth when temperatures drop below -15 degrees Celsius.

In which months do I bloom and for how long?
The plant blooms in the months of April and May, and the flowering period lasts approximately 2 to 3 weeks.
Can I tolerate full sun?
The plant is better off being planted in a location with partial shade to shade, as it is sensitive to bright sun. The leaves can burn with prolonged exposure to full sun. It is therefore advisable to protect the plant from direct sunlight.
